Proforest and Daemeter will be jointly presenting a RSPO-endorsed Lead Auditor training course in Belitung, Indonesia, 28th September – 2nd October 2015.
The 5-day Lead Auditor training course is designed for assessors who want to carry out audits for the Roundtable for Sustainable Palm Oil (RSPO); company staff who want in-depth knowledge of RSPO requirements and how to meet them; and stakeholders, such as NGOs or government officials, who want a rigorous introduction to RSPO standards and systems.
The course includes lectures, workshops, a practical audit exercise and a written examination. Endorsed by the RSPO, the course provides lead auditors and other participants with an in-depth knowledge of the RSPO Principles and Criteria and their implementation. It focuses on application of the RSPO Certification Systems and audit practice requirements to ensure consistent and appropriate audit decision-making.
The course will be conducted in Bahasa Indonesia. All participants are expected to have some basic knowledge of the RSPO Principles & Criteria (P&C). A questionnaire will be provided and must be completed before the course.
